Answer to Question 1

A food-borne infection occurs when someone eats food that is contaminated with harmful microorganisms and that makes you sick. An example is Salmonella. A food intoxication is the result of ingestion of a toxin or poison produced by a microorganism in the food and that makes one sick. An example is Staph.
